Malaysia's AI Jobs Market Is Growing Faster Than Talent Supply {#market-growth}
AI-related job postings in Malaysia climbed sharply to about 2% of all advertised roles in 2024, up from 1% in 2021 — reflecting strong demand even as the broader job market cooled. That doubling of share may sound modest in isolation, but it represents a significant acceleration when measured against overall hiring volumes across the economy.
This trend is backed by substantial investment momentum: Malaysia's digital economy hit a record RM163.6 billion in 2024, and PwC's 2025 Global AI Jobs Barometer — which analysed nearly a billion job ads and financial reports from 24 territories — confirmed that Malaysia is one of the markets experiencing AI's significant impact on jobs, wages, skills, and productivity.
Malaysia's national push toward a digital economy is rapidly increasing the value of AI talent, with the country developing a dynamic and growing ecosystem for AI professionals driven by strong government support and private sector adoption. What makes Malaysia's position particularly interesting from a regional standpoint is its cost-competitiveness relative to Singapore, its strategic infrastructure investments, and its positioning as a production and deployment hub for AI across ASEAN.
The Sectors Driving AI Hiring in Malaysia {#sectors}
The information and communication sector leads the way, with AI-related job postings rising from 4.4% to 5.4% between 2021 and 2024. The manufacturing sector is also accelerating, with AI-driven role listings increasing from 1.4% to 2.9% in just one year between 2023 and 2024 alone.
The government's MyDIGITAL blueprint — a key driver of AI job creation — aims to make AI a core part of Malaysia's economy, while major industries including finance, Islamic finance, high-tech manufacturing, and agriculture are heavily investing in AI to improve efficiency and create new products.
From Kuala Lumpur startups to established tech clusters in Penang and Johor, companies are investing in AI for manufacturing, finance, healthcare, and more. This geographic spread matters: Kuala Lumpur dominates for corporate and startup roles, while Penang is emerging as the hub for hardware, semiconductor, and industrial AI projects. Each cluster has distinct hiring profiles and salary dynamics that professionals and employers should understand before making decisions.
Kuala Lumpur is a growing hub for FinTech, where AI engineers are essential for developing fraud detection systems, credit scoring models, and personalised financial service applications. Meanwhile, the healthcare sector presents a different picture — one where human expertise remains dominant, but AI-assisted diagnostics and operational automation are beginning to create new hybrid roles that blend clinical knowledge with data literacy.
In-Demand AI Roles: What Employers Are Hiring For {#roles}
Common AI roles in Malaysia include data scientist, machine learning engineer, AI research engineer, data engineer, and AI product manager. But the hiring landscape has matured well beyond these foundational titles. Organisations are increasingly looking for professionals who can bridge technical capabilities with business context — people who understand not just how to build models, but how to deploy them in ways that generate measurable commercial value.
This creates demand for senior in-house roles such as AI solution architects, AI tech leads, and AI specialists who can appoint and manage vendors and then oversee projects end-to-end. These senior positions are among the hardest to fill, and companies routinely find themselves competing against one another — and against global tech firms — for a very limited pool of experienced candidates.
New specialisations are also emerging, including Generative AI Engineer, AI Ethicist, and MLOps Engineer — roles that often offer high pay because the skills required are still rare. For professionals already working in software engineering, data analytics, or product management, these emerging titles represent accessible transition pathways rather than entirely new careers.
There is also a growing need for junior AI engineers and data engineers who can work on AI-driven projects. Many companies are hiring skilled talent with transferable skills from software engineering, particularly in Python, big data, and cloud technologies, who may not have direct AI exposure but are willing to transition into AI-focused roles. This willingness to hire for potential alongside pedigree is significant — it means the entry threshold into AI roles in Malaysia is lower than many candidates assume.
Leading employers are not only hiring for technical roles but also for AI ethics, policy, and project management positions, reflecting the maturing ecosystem. Business leaders, HR professionals, and consultants who develop even a working command of AI concepts are finding themselves highly valued in this environment.
AI Salaries in Malaysia: What You Can Expect to Earn {#salaries}
Salary data for AI roles in Malaysia varies considerably by experience level, location, sector, and specialisation — but the consistent signal across multiple sources is that AI-related roles command significant premiums over comparable non-AI positions.
For full-time roles, the average annual salary of an AI engineer in Malaysia ranges from RM 96,000 to RM 240,000. Salaries are highest in Kuala Lumpur and are significantly influenced by a developer's expertise in cloud AI platforms such as AWS and Azure, Python, and machine learning frameworks.
The average data scientist salary in Malaysia sits at around RM 90,000 per year, with higher pay in cities like Kuala Lumpur. Entry-level data scientists earn between RM 5,750 and RM 8,250 per month, while senior roles can reach RM 21,600 or more.
Technology, finance, and healthcare sectors offer some of the highest pay for data science professionals. The Robert Walters Salary Survey 2025 shows that data scientists in tech can earn between RM 144,000 and RM 240,000 per year.
Skill transitions also have a direct salary impact worth quantifying. Switching from non-AI to AI roles can result in up to a 35.8% salary increase. Moving from machine learning to deep learning roles offers a further 23.6% increase, while transitioning from SQL to Python skills alone can boost pay by 18.8%. These figures make a compelling case for deliberate, targeted upskilling as a financial strategy — not just a career development exercise.
For candidates moving between organisations, those switching jobs in 2025 could expect a salary increase in the region of 25%, with more junior roles in the AI space seeing increments of 30–35%.
Skills Employers Are Looking For {#skills}
Technical skills form the foundation of most AI hiring briefs in Malaysia, but the picture is more nuanced than a simple list of tools and frameworks. Employers are increasingly screening for a combination of technical proficiency, domain knowledge, and the kind of higher-order thinking that AI cannot yet replicate.
Core technical skills in demand:
Employers typically look for skills in Python, machine learning frameworks like TensorFlow or PyTorch, SQL, data preprocessing, model deployment, and cloud platforms such as AWS, GCP, or Azure.
- Proficiency in Python and relevant ML libraries
- Experience with cloud platforms (AWS, Azure, Google Cloud)
- Data engineering and pipeline management
- Model deployment and MLOps capabilities
- Natural language processing (NLP) and computer vision
- Familiarity with large language models (LLMs) and generative AI tools
Domain knowledge in fintech, healthcare, or manufacturing can be a strong differentiator, particularly for candidates applying to sector-specific roles where understanding the business context is as important as the technical execution.
Human skills matter just as much:
Key areas for skill development include proficiency in data analysis, programming, and machine learning, as well as soft skills like adaptability, emotional intelligence, and communication skills. This balance is not just a formality — as AI handles more routine analytical tasks, the professionals who can translate findings into strategic decisions, communicate clearly with non-technical stakeholders, and lead cross-functional projects are the ones commanding premium salaries.
Human social intelligence, complex psycho-emotional reasoning, creativity, and critical thinking continue to maintain significant competitive advantages over AI systems and could command increasing wage premiums as generative AI adoption accelerates. For business professionals who may not be pursuing purely technical roles, this is an important reminder: AI literacy combined with sharp human judgment is a powerful, differentiated skill set.
The shift away from degree requirements:
Employer demand for formal degrees is declining, especially quickly for AI-exposed jobs. The percentage of jobs AI augments that require a degree fell from 66% to 59% between 2019 and 2024, and fell from 53% to 44% for jobs AI automates. This is meaningful for mid-career professionals looking to transition — demonstrated skills, certifications, and portfolio work are increasingly competitive with traditional academic credentials.
Why AI Skills Command a Premium — And What That Means for Wages {#wage-premium}
The wage data coming out of global and Malaysia-specific research is striking. Jobs requiring AI skills now command an average wage premium of 56% over similar roles that do not require such skills — more than double the 25% premium observed just the previous year. That rapid acceleration suggests the market is still in the early stages of pricing in AI competency, and those who move now are likely to benefit most from the current premium.
Wage growth in AI-exposed industries in Malaysia is running at twice the rate of other sectors. This accelerated growth is seen in both automatable roles, where many tasks can be completed by AI, and augmentable roles, where AI enhances or supports human judgment and expertise.
Since generative AI's proliferation in 2022, productivity growth has nearly quadrupled in industries most exposed to AI — rising from 7% between 2018–2022 to 27% between 2018–2024. For business leaders, this is not an abstract statistic. It means that companies investing in AI-capable talent and enterprise-wide AI integration are generating measurably more value per employee than those that are not.
Certified AI professionals can command up to 30% more pay, which makes structured certification programmes a direct lever for salary growth — not just a credential to list on a CV.
The Talent Gap: Malaysia's Biggest AI Challenge {#talent-gap}
For all of the optimism around Malaysia's AI trajectory, one number defines the urgency of the moment: the World Bank estimates that Malaysia has only 3,000 AI professionals today, while demand is expected to reach 30,000 by 2030. That tenfold gap is not a distant problem — it is already showing up as a bottleneck in hiring decisions across sectors.
The country faces a significant AI talent shortage. A 2024 Amazon Web Services report found that 81% of Malaysian employers struggled to hire AI talent, despite 90% prioritising AI skills. These figures reveal a mismatch that goes beyond supply and demand — it reflects a structural lag between how quickly businesses are adopting AI and how quickly the education and training ecosystem is producing job-ready professionals.
A report by MDEC indicated that 70% of new job openings in 2024 require digital skills, yet only 30% of the current workforce is equipped with these competencies. Meanwhile, 56% of employers are grappling with a shortage of talent possessing the necessary skills for their organisations.
A 2025 World Economic Forum study projected that approximately 620,000 jobs in Malaysia are at high risk of automation — often the routine, semi-skilled roles. But the same study identified 60 emerging job roles, with 70% concentrated in AI and digital technologies, hinting at the potential creation of hundreds of thousands of new, high-value positions.
To address the pipeline problem, a range of public and private initiatives are scaling up. Public-private collaborations are ramping up AI education — for instance, Microsoft's AIForMYFuture initiative aims to train 800,000 Malaysians by 2025 through online modules and hands-on workshops. Microsoft has committed to investing $2.2 billion in Malaysia's AI and cloud infrastructure and training 300,000 people to enhance digital skills. Meanwhile, universities including Universiti Malaya, Universiti Teknologi Malaysia, and Monash University Malaysia have expanded AI and data science degree offerings.
Still, according to the 2025 QS World Future Skills report, Malaysia ranks 33rd globally and 7th in Asia in higher education readiness — yet the contrast between academic preparedness and the country's capacity for economic transformation suggests a fundamental disconnect between education systems and industry requirements. Bridging this gap will require more than government programmes alone. It demands that businesses take ownership of upskilling, that professionals pursue continuous learning, and that the broader AI ecosystem creates better pathways between knowledge and application.
What Business Leaders Should Do Now {#business-leaders}
For executives and business leaders, the data points in one clear direction: AI adoption is no longer a future consideration. It is a present competitive requirement. The question is not whether to invest, but how to do so in ways that generate sustained returns.
Use AI as a growth strategy, not just an efficiency play. The most significant returns from AI are not coming from headcount reduction. Companies are using AI to help workers create more value — and those that use AI only to reduce staff numbers may miss out on the much bigger opportunities to claim new markets or generate new revenue streams.
Invest in your people alongside your technology. With 56% of employers grappling with skills shortages, 52% of them are planning to increase their hiring budgets specifically for technical skills and roles. But hiring alone will not close a tenfold talent gap. Internal upskilling, reskilling programmes, and structured learning pathways are critical.
Build trust and governance into your AI deployment. The growth dividend from AI is not guaranteed — it depends on more than just technical success. It also hinges on responsible deployment, clear governance, and public and organisational trust. Malaysia's regulatory landscape is evolving quickly, and companies that get ahead of governance requirements will be better positioned for investment and partnership.

How to Break Into or Advance in Malaysia's AI Job Market {#career-entry}
For individuals — whether fresh graduates, mid-career professionals considering a transition, or specialists looking to deepen their expertise — Malaysia's AI jobs market is genuinely full of opportunity. The talent gap works in candidates' favour, and employers have become increasingly pragmatic about qualifications.
Remote and hybrid opportunities are increasing, making it possible to work for international companies while based in Malaysia — which means local professionals can access global salary benchmarks without relocating. This dynamic is drawing more talent into the AI field and raising the bar for what employers need to offer to attract and retain people.
Practical steps to enter or advance in the AI job market:
- Build foundational technical skills in Python, SQL, and at least one ML framework before pursuing specialisation
- Pursue relevant certifications — cloud and AI certifications from AWS, Microsoft, or Google carry genuine market weight
- Develop domain expertise in a target sector such as fintech, healthcare, or manufacturing, as this combination of technical and industry knowledge is highly differentiated
- Create a portfolio with real-world or local-context projects that demonstrate not just capability but business relevance
- Stay current with emerging roles such as MLOps engineer, AI product manager, and generative AI specialist, where demand is rising fastest
Employers increasingly value AI competence over formal degrees — skills often yield a 23% wage premium, reducing the weight of degree requirements. This shift opens the field to professionals from diverse backgrounds who are willing to invest in continuous learning.
